Choose deep-research if…
- deep-research is primarily TypeScript; llm-wiki-agent is Python.
- Requirements: Requires Docker.
- Tags unique to deep-research: agent, ai, gpt, o3-mini.
- deep-research ships Docker support for self-hosted deployment.
- When you need a tool that can refine its topic focus over time through repeated iterations.
When NOT to use deep-research
- When you prefer a language other than TypeScript, as deep-research specifically requires a Node.js environment.
- If your use case does not necessitate the use of both Firecrawl and OpenAI APIs, preferring instead solutions with more API flexibility or that do not require API keys.
Choose llm-wiki-agent if…
- llm-wiki-agent is primarily Python; deep-research is TypeScript.
- Tags unique to llm-wiki-agent: ai-agent, automation, knowledge-base, llm.
- When you need to create an interlinked wiki without setting up API keys or configuring Python environments.
When NOT to use llm-wiki-agent
- If the process requires strict privacy controls and no third-party AI agents can be used.
- When your project needs real-time interaction with APIs for dynamic content integration, as llm-wiki-agent does not support API-driven operations.
